Overloaded Truck Risks and the Legal Rights of Accident Victims

Critical Facts: Overloaded Truck Risks Overloaded truck risks are among the most dangerous conditions on U.S. highways. When a commercial truck exceeds its legal weight limit, stopping distances increase dramatically, tires blow out more easily, and the driver loses critical control — leaving innocent victims seriously injured or killed. Driver Fatigue Accidents: How Victims Can Recover Maximum Compensation

Common Truck Challenges: Driver Fatigue Accidents Driver fatigue accidents are among the most preventable — and most devastating — crashes on American highways. According to the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ration (FMCSA), fatigued driving contributes to approximately 13% of all commercial truck crashes.
